Recap: NY Yankees vs. Oakland
13th May 2006, 09:45 GMT
Chien-Ming Wang dazzled on the mound by blanking the Athletics over eight innings, helping the New York Yankees to a 2-0 victory over Oakland in the opener of a three-game series. Wang (3-1) was tremendous for the Yankees, allowing just three hits and two walks while recording 20 of his 24 outs on ground balls. He improved to 2-0 over his last four starts and received plenty of help, as Oakland hit into five double plays.
